Immigration Requirements for Newly Arrived International Students

New international students are requested to report to OSA upon their arrival to the University for proper advising to fulfill certain arrival obligations related to their legal stay.  Student visa    9(f) and Exchange Student visa 
47(a)(2)
holders follow slightly different procedures.  The OSA assigns a liaison staff to accompany and assist the students in going to the proper government agencies.  Students are requested to make an appointment with the Coordinator and prepare all the necessary requirements before the scheduled trip.

Exchange Students  Visa Holders/Applicants 
under Section 47(a)(2)

2.1.      47(a)(2) Application (Department of Justice)

The OSA prepares the necessary endorsement after the exchange student/fellow submits the following requirements:

  • Passport

  • Memorandum of Agreement (MOA) of Exchange Program and/or Scholarship Agreement

  • Appointment as official exchange fellow or scholar

  • Acceptance signed by the subject foreign national

  • Affidavit of Support and Bank Certificate

  • Marriage contract (for dependent spouse) and or Birth Certificates for dependent children

  • Extension of scholarship (additional requirement for visa extension)

   Fees:
        Filing                         P 200.00
        Legal                              30.00 
        Notarization                     50.00
